------------------------------- Materials
- felt cut in 6 1/2" X 6 1/2" squares in various colours - embroidery floss - needle - scissors - quilt batting - sewing machine - a purchased copy of the pattern or printouts of farm animals
First, cut out six squares of felt that are 6 1/2" x 6 1/2". These will be the pages of your book.
Cut out strips of felt in various widths and shapes and sew these along the bottom edge of of your pages (the back page is left blank). These strips will form the 'ground' that your farm animals stand on. See photos for some ideas on how to do this.

Trace your pattern pieces onto your felt in the colours you think suitable. Then, stitch the animals onto your pages using two strands of embroidery floss.
Using the Stitchery Garden as a guide, or your own imagination, add in embroidered details onto your felt pages. Here are some suggestions...

Using five strands of embroidery floss, embroider on the sounds each animal makes and the title of your book.

Centre of piece of 6" x 6" quilt batting between two of your pages (wrong sides facing). 
Making a scant 1/8" seam, machine sew the two felt pages together to make one complete page. Repeat for the other four pieces of felt until you have three complete pages in total.
Hand sew all of your pages together by making small straight stitches over the top of your machine stitches. (Hand sewing is recommended as the book is too bulky to fit through the sewing machine).
